1. Ukulinganisa okunembile kakhulu
Ama-rain gauge e-piezoelectric asebenzisa umphumela we-piezoelectric ukuguqula umthelela wamanzi emvula abe amasignali kagesi ukuze kulinganiswe ngokunembile imvula. Anokuzwela okuphezulu futhi angabamba ngokunembile ulwazi mayelana nenani elincane lemvula kanye nemvula enkulu esheshayo, anikeze abasebenzisi idatha yesimo sezulu enemininingwane eminingi. Lokhu kulinganisa okunembile kuyisisekelo sokwenza izinqumo zesayensi ezimbonini eziningi ezifana nezolimo, i-meteorology, kanye nokuvikelwa kwemvelo.
2. Ukudluliswa kwedatha ngesikhathi sangempela
Amageyiji emvula e-piezoelectric yesimanje avame ukuhlonyiswa ngemisebenzi yokudlulisa engenantambo, engadlulisela idatha yokuqapha efwini noma kusizindalwazi sendawo ngesikhathi sangempela, okuvumela abasebenzisi ukuthi babuke futhi bahlaziye izimo zemvula nganoma yisiphi isikhathi. Ngohlelo lokusebenza lweselula olusekelayo noma isofthiwe yekhompyutha, abasebenzisi bangathola idatha ngokushesha futhi baphendule ngokushesha, okuthuthukisa kakhulu ukusebenza kahle kanye nokusebenza kahle kokuqapha.
3. Iqinile futhi ihlala isikhathi eside
Igeyiji yemvula ye-piezoelectric yenziwe ngezinto ezinamandla aphezulu futhi inokumelana okuhle kakhulu nesimo sezulu kanye nokumelana nokugqwala. Kungakhathaliseki ukuthi izimo zezulu ezinzima njengokushisa okuphezulu, izinga lokushisa eliphansi, imvula, iqhwa noma umoya onamandla, igeyiji yemvula ye-piezoelectric isakwazi ukusebenza kahle, iqinisekisa ukuqapha okuphephile nokuthembekile isikhathi eside.
4. Kulula ukufaka nokunakekela
Uma kuqhathaniswa nama-rain gauge endabuko, i-piezoelectric rain gauge inomklamo olula kanye nenqubo yokufaka elula. Abasebenzisi badinga ukulandela imiyalelo kuphela ukuze bayimise. Futhi izindleko zayo zokulungisa ziphansi, akudingeki ukulinganisa njalo nokuqaqa, okunciphisa kakhulu ubunzima kanye nezindleko zomsebenzi wokulungisa.
5. Ukuvikelwa kwemvelo nokonga amandla
Igeyiji yemvula ye-piezoelectric isebenzisa amandla amancane kakhulu lapho isebenza, futhi amamodeli amaningi nawo asebenza ngamandla elanga, okunciphisa kakhulu izindleko zokusebenzisa kanye nomthelela emvelweni. Njengedivayisi yokuqapha eluhlaza, igeyiji yemvula ye-piezoelectric ihambisana kakhulu nomqondo wesimanje wokuvikela imvelo futhi ifanele ukusetshenziswa ezimweni ezahlukahlukene.
